I came home the other night to find my x32 on the table, resting ontop of a smelly puddle of cat urine. After cleaning the mess, i turn on the laptop with crossed fingers and everything seems ok. Infact, everything is perfect (except for the heat-activated odor).
A few days later I goto charge the laptop and nothing happens. I try the dock, i try switching batteries, nothing happens. I figure the circuitry is corroded with acidic cat urine, so i disassemble the whole laptop and give it the rubbing alcohol treatment. Still no charge.
What really ticks me off is the fact that the laptop still functions on the remaining battery life...5%. Any input would be greatly appreciated. Im THIS close to scrapping the parts and auctioning them off ebay.
